Replication section of the Connectivity & security tab in the read replica details. As a result, youre freed from the complexity and costs of planning, purchasing, and maintaining hardware. disaster recovery. RDS for Oracle read replicas. There are multiple ways to reduce your Amazon RDS costs, including rightsizing your databases for your needs. Databases page in the RDS console, it shows Primary in the As a result, you Create an Amazon RDS MySQL cross-Region replica in - AWS re:Post Sign in to the AWS Management Console and open the Amazon RDS console at Accessing AWS services in same Region Accessing services across AWS Regions If your workload accesses services in different Regions (Figure 2), there is a charge for data transfer across Regions. Configuring and managing a Multi-AZ deployment. fails. RDS uses the service-linked role to verify the authorization in the source Region. To create a read replica in a different AWS Region from the source DB instance, you can use the AWS CLI create-db-instance-read-replica operations. No. 2023, Amazon Web Services, Inc. or its affiliates. Once you have made a reserved purchase, using a reserved instance is no different than an on-demand DB instance. An ARN uniquely identifies a resource created in Amazon Web Services. replicas. I/O suspension for backups or scheduled maintenance. Traffic that crosses a Regional boundary will typically incur a data transfer charge. Our system will automatically apply your reservation(s) such that all eligible DB instances are charged at the lower hourly reserved DB instance rate. the source DB instance status remains modifying, the read replica status remains following: Writing to tables with indexes on a read replica. role during the replication creation process, the creation fails. replication. only) DDL operations, such as creating or rebuilding of the DB snapshot page in the console reports how far the DB snapshot creation has progressed. source-instance-1, you are charged for the data transfers to all three replicas. Amazon RDS uses the following process to create a cross-Region read replica. Scale read operations into an AWS Region closer to your users. If the read_only parameter is not set to 0 on the If you create all three replicas directly from You can also see the status of a read replica using the AWS CLI describe-db-instances command or the Amazon RDS API --db-instance-identifier The identifier for the read replica in the destination You only pay forwhat you use with no minimum or set up fees. following information doesn't apply to setting up replication with an instance that replica in another Availability Zone for failover support for the replica. Direct Connect can be used to connect workloads in AWS to on-premises networks. For information about using read replicas with a specific engine, see the Reserved instances receive a significant discount compared to on-demand instances. To learn more about You can pay for Amazon RDS using on-demand orreserved instances. replicas, Read replicas in a If you create a read replica in a different VPC from the source DB instance, One option to connect workloads to an on-premises network is to use one or more Site-to-Site VPN connections (Figure 8 Pattern 1). Availability Chaos Engineering Failover Cross-Region Migration Resiliency 3. When you create a read replica, Amazon RDS takes a DB snapshot of your source DB instance and begins replication. instance in a VPC. As part ofAWS Free Tier,AWS customers receive 100 GB of free data transfer out to the internet free each month, aggregated across all AWS Services and Regions (except China and GovCloud). load is complete, the read replica status is set to available, and the DB snapshot copy is Youcan easily start and stop your database instances to simply and affordablydevelop and test your applications. Here are some general tips for when you start planning your architecture: AWS provides the ability to deploy across multiple Availability Zones and Regions. Amazon RDS doesn't support circular replication. Actions taken on the Provisioned IOPS per month Provisioned IOPS rate, regardless of IOPS consumed (for Amazon RDS Provisioned IOPS storage only). Direct Connect can also connect to the Transit Gateway (via Direct Connect Gateway) if multiple VPCs need to be connected (Figure 9). For example, you can For a successful request, specify both the source instance and the replica. The status doesn't transition from replication degraded to error, unless an error These cross-Region replication read replica in a different Region from the source DB instance. out the key space (if you are splitting rows) or distribution of tables for each In this case, you call CreateDBInstanceReadReplica from the You can't specify a custom parameter group when you use the problem. Data transfer from AWS to the internet is charged per service, with rates specific to the originating Region. types, Restrictions for more information about troubleshooting a replication error, see Troubleshooting a MySQL read replica Amazon RDS costs will vary basedon customer needs. source. Cross-region replication for Aurora MySQL uses MySQL binary replication to replay changes on the cross-Region read replica DB cluster. mechanisms for deleting a DB instance. Cost elements for Transit Gateway include an hourly charge for each attached VPC, AWS Direct Connect, or AWS Site-to-Site VPN. Choose the read replica that you want to promote. roles, Managing AWS STS in an The following procedures show how to create a read replica from a source MariaDB, Microsoft SQL Server, MySQL, Oracle, or PostgreSQL DB instance Session tokens from the global AWS Security Token Service (AWS STS) endpoint are valid only in AWS Regions that are enabled by default replicated data up to the point when the request was made to To learn more The ReplicaLag metric returns the value of the following query. You can create a read replica across AWS Regions using the AWS Management Console. To learn more about encrypting the source DB instance, see significant differences you should know about, as shown in the following Following a billable status change, such as creating, starting, or modifying your DB instance type, you will be billed based on partial DB instance hours. read-only access to the replica. The data transferred for cross-Region replication incurs Amazon RDS data transfer charges. You can replicate between the GovCloud (US-East) and GovCloud (US-West) Regions, but not into or out of GovCloud (US). New databases aren't included in the lag calculation until they are accessible on the read replica. There is no additional charge for storage of the DB transaction logs. For the MySQL and Oracle DB engines, you can specify a custom parameter group for the read replica in the Seeprevious generation instancesfor previous instance pricing not listed here. AWS Region of the source DB instance. For example, if must be valid in both Regions, which is true for opt-in Regions only when the regional AWS STS endpoint is used. In his spare time, he tries his hand at new recipes from across the world in the kitchen. RDS for SQL Server read replicas. Implementing failure recovery You The progress column of the DB snapshot display indicates how far the copy has RDS - Cross-Region Replication :: Disaster Recovery on AWS 1. According to IDC research, Amazon RDS customerscan lower their total database operating costs by an average of 40% over threeyears, achieving a 264% return on investment. Thanks for letting us know we're doing a good job! Communication with the source Region is made by RDS on the requester's behalf. be encrypted. least 10 percent. Then you can Logs are purged from the source DB instance after replication degraded (SQL Server only) Replicas are this way, you can elastically scale out beyond the capacity constraints of a single DB instance An active, long-running transaction can slow the process of creating the read replica. --db-subnet-group-name parameter must specify a DB subnet group from the same VPC. which is the DB instance identifier of the source DB instance that you want to replicate from. These charges vary depending on where the components are deployed. Amazon RDS is free to try and you pay only for what you use with no minimum fees. exception is the RDS for Oracle DB engine, which supports replica databases in mounted mode. Client have read/write access to the primary DB instance and CreateDBInstanceReadReplica For more information on version and Region availability with cross-Region replication, see Customers have a number of deployment options for Amazon RDS including on-premises environments using Amazon RDS on Outposts, using Amazon RDS Custom for privileged access to underlying database for applications like Oracle E-Business Suite, or running Amazon RDS Proxy to make applications more scalable, resilient, and secure. It actions generate charges for the data transferred out of the source AWS Region: When you create a read replica, Amazon RDS takes a snapshot of the source instance and transfers the snapshot to the Managed Relational Database - Amazon RDS Pricing - Amazon Web Services required for mounted replicas. For more information about data transfer pricing, see Amazon RDS pricing. When you promote a read replica, the new DB instance that is created retains the Replica. He works with Greenfield customers, helping them get started on their cloud journey with AWS, and is passionate about containers, serverless, and cost optimization. replica unstable, which can negatively impact applications connecting to it. AWS support for Internet Explorer ends on 07/31/2022. There are several reasons you might want to promote a read replica to a standalone DB Data processing charges apply for each GB sent from a VPC, Direct Connect, or VPN to Transit Gateway. To view the details for a read replica, choose the name of the read replica in the list of DB instances in the Amazon RDS console. For more information, see secondary_lag_seconds in the Microsoft documentation. The source DB instance must be encrypted. Promoting a read replica to be a standalone DB instance, Creating a read replica in a different AWS Region, Working with Multi-AZ DB cluster read replicas, Use cases for read To create an encrypted read replica, the source DB instance must be encrypted. as a replication source for an existing DB instance. Sign in to the AWS Management Console and open the Amazon RDS console at https://console.aws.amazon.com/rds/. It has the same Replicating Amazon Aurora MySQL DB clusters across AWS Regions If you've got a moment, please tell us what we did right so we can do more of it. A This requirement also applies to a read replica that is problem, Monitoring Amazon RDS metrics with Amazon CloudWatch, Working with Amazon Resource Names (ARNs) in Amazon RDS, Using service-linked affected read replica. VPC or VPC endpoint. 1. source DB instance. Replication is terminated. With reserved instances, you can reserve a DB instance for a one- or three-year term. For RDS for Oracle 19c, cross-Region read replicas are available for instances of Oracle Database 19c that aren't container database (CBD) instances. You have to promote the read replica manually or delete it. algorithm to determine which host receives a given update. redo logs. If you need to use one of the previous conditions that would cause a request to fail, you can include a second Cross-Region automated backups are charged for the data transferred to copy the Amazon RDS DB snapshot and DB transaction logs across Regions. identifier of the source instance, and is the date and time the copy started. If you try to increase the value by less than 10 percent, you Cross-region automated backups replication is a cost-effective strategy that helps save on compute costs. You can use the AWS Management Console, run the create-db-instance-read-replica command, or call the CreateDBInstanceReadReplica API Regions and Zones 2. for the secondary replicas. automated snapshot in the destination AWS Region with a status of creating. For SQL Server, the ReplicaLag metric is the maximum lag of databases that have fallen behind, in seconds. By default, a read replica is created with the same storage type as the source DB Select one of the Amazon RDS database (DB) engines below to view pricing. operation with the following required parameters: You can promote a read replica into a standalone DB instance. recommend that you enable backups and complete at least one backup prior to promotion. If a source DB instance has several read replicas, promoting two hours or after the archive log retention hours setting has If a primary DB instance has no cross-Region read replicas, Amazon RDS passed, whichever is longer. creation. enable automatic backups on the source DB instance by setting the backup retention 1 Answer Sorted by: 0 RDS doesn't support Multi-Region multi-master setups, i.e. Workload components across Availability Zones. messages being written to the log. RDS - Cross-Region Backups :: Disaster Recovery on AWS If you've got a moment, please tell us what we did right so we can do more of it. When using a Direct Connect gateway, there will be outbound data charges based on the source Region and Direct Connect location (Figure 10). replica from a source Amazon RDS DB instance that is not a read replica of another Amazon RDS DB instance. The source-region option is required for cross-Region replication between the AWS GovCloud (US-East) and AWS GovCloud (US-West) Regions when the DB cluster indicated by replication-source-identifier is encrypted. Promote the read replica by using the Promote option on the Amazon RDS Learn more about Amazon RDS reserved instances, Click here for pricing on Amazon RDS reserved instances. By only stopping an Amazon RDS DB instance, you stop billing for additional instance hours, but you will still incur storage costs. --source-db-instance-identifier The DB instance identifier for the source DB instance. automatic backups. the destination AWS Region. V$DATAGUARD_STATS in the Oracle documentation. Applications connect to a read replica just as they do to any DB instance. the source DB instance for another read replica. cross-Region read replica instances. An authorization for RDS to access the source DB instance is created. roles in the IAM User Guide. Amazon RDS costs will vary basedon customer needs. For data transferred between an EC2 instance and an Amazon RDS DB instance in different Availability Zones of the same Region, EC2 Regional Data Transfer charges apply on both sides of transfer. storage type for the read replica. configurations needed to enable the secure channel, such as adding security group If you've got a moment, please tell us how we can make the documentation better. During this phase, the replication lag time for the Replication with the standby When the reboot is You are onlycharged for the data transfer in or out of the EC2 instance and standard EC2Regional Data Transfer charges apply ($.01 per GB in/out). If you are using a MariaDB version option group and the parameter group of the former read replica. Amazon RDS for Oracle and SQL Server allow you to add up to 5 read replicas to each DB Instance. to make it writable. following sections: Working with read replicas for Microsoft SQL Server in Amazon RDS, Working with read replicas for Amazon RDS for Oracle, Working with read replicas for Amazon RDS for PostgreSQL. recommend that you use the same or larger DB instance class and The snapshot copy is listed as an is complete, the status of both the DB snapshot and source DB instance are set to These requests might fail because when RDS makes the call to the remote Region, it isn't from the specified Figure 1. For example, if your source DB instance is in the US East (N. Virginia) Region, the ARN looks similar to this You aren't charged for the data transferred from read-replica-1 to the Use Direct Connect instead of the internet for sending data to on-premises networks. With on-demand instances, you pay for compute capacity per hour your DB instance runs. haven't been applied. The Partial Upfront payment option is a hybrid of the All Upfront and No Upfront options. terminated (MariaDB, MySQL, or PostgreSQL only) experience a brief I/O suspension on your source DB instance while the DB snapshot occurs. Automatic backups and manual snapshots are supported on As long as your reservation purchase is active, Amazon RDS will apply the reduced hourly rate for which you are eligible to the new DB instance. command from the destination AWS Region. RDS - Cross-Region Backups :: Disaster Recovery on AWS 1. about the pre-signed-url option, see create-db-instance-read-replica in the AWS CLI Command Reference. that dictates how many write ahead log (WAL) files are kept to When the settings are as you want them, choose for information related to deleting the source DB instance for a cross-Region read you must set the read_only parameter to 0 in the DB specify both the source and destination Regions. instead of SHOW REPLICA STATUS. Learn more about Amazon RDS on-demand instances, Click here for pricing on Amazon RDS on-demand instances. service-linked IAM role. instance. https://console.aws.amazon.com/rds/. This can occur, for DB instance. instance: Performing DDL operations (MySQL and MariaDB different Availability Zone (AZ). To create an encrypted read replica in a different AWS Region from the source DB instance, the source DB instance must determine when all updates have been made to the read replica. load on your primary DB instance by routing queries from your applications to the read replica. If the VPCs are peered across Regions, standard inter-Region data transfer charges will apply (Figure 6). replica after the archive log retention hours setting has passed once the read replica is in sync with its primary DB instance. replica, choose a different destination DB subnet group. read replica don't affect the performance of the primary DB instance. You can direct this excess read traffic to During the creation of an automated DB snapshot, Another option to connect multiple VPCs to an on-premises network is to use a Site-to-Site VPN connection to a Transit Gateway (Figure 8 Pattern 2). You can monitor the status of a read replica in several ways. Accessing AWS services in same Region. create-db-instance-read-replica. transmitted and applied to all cross-Region read VPC peering using Transit Gateway in same Region. A Direct Connect gateway can be used to share a Direct Connect across multiple Regions. RDS for Oracle replicas. one of the read replicas to a DB instance has no effect on the other replicas. classless inter-domain routing (CIDR) ranges can overlap between the replica and the RDS system. AWS Region in the IAM User Guide. entries. aws rds describe-db-clusters --db-cluster . mounted replica doesn't accept user connections and so can't serve a read-only between the AWS GovCloud (US-East) and AWS GovCloud (US-West) Regions. Using a nontransactional storage engine such as MyISAM. Amazon RDS then uses the asynchronous replication method for the DB Figure 3. Billing continues until the DB instance terminates, which would occur when upon deletion or in the event of an instance failure. AWS Region. or IAM user) must have access to the source DB instance and the source Region. In this example, you are only charged for the data transferred from source-instance-1 to because of a customer-initiated request. the source DB instance. AWS Region, Provisioned IOPS, General Purpose, TO 'repl_user'@'<domain_name>'; 5. Amazon RDS creates an automated DB snapshot of the source DB instance in the source AWS Region. According to IDC research, Amazon RDS customerscan lower their total database operating costs by an average of 40% over threeyears, achieving a 264% return on investment. the DB instance is rebooted before it becomes available. RDS for MySQL or RDS for MariaDB read replicas. other two replicas because they are all in the same AWS Region. read replica, it can break replication. Yes. You can then perform all needed DDL retention period and the backup window for the newly promoted DB The primary use for mounted replicas is cross-Region creating. Please see the AWS Free Tier FAQs for more information. Because Amazon RDS DB engines implement replication differently, there are several Sebastian is based out of New York City and outside of work loves spending time with his family and friends. one or more read replicas. following extra considerations apply when replicating between AWS Regions: A source DB instance can have cross-Region read replicas in multiple AWS Regions. deleted, the read replica is promoted. Cross-Region read replicas for RDS for Oracle are available in all Regions with the following version limitations: For RDS for Oracle 21c, cross-Region read replicas aren't available. You can promote The requester's policy has a condition for aws:SourceVpc or aws:SourceVpce. If you wish to run more than 40 DB instances, please complete the Amazon RDS DB Instance request form.
Professional Facilitator Salary, Roosevelt Park Apartments, Monteverde Parker Refills, Al Haramain L Aventure Perfume, Articles A